Welcome aboard! One thing that trips up new release managers: the Bramblewick admin dashboard ships dark mode behind a feature flag, not a user toggle. Before cutting a release, confirm the theme bundle built for both palettes, or QA will bounce it back. Tess usually double-checks contrast ratios, but it's on you to verify the flag state. The full flag checklist lives on our internal page here:

operations page: https://confluence.qorvellabs.internal/pages/projects/projects/projects

## Incremental rebuilds — Pressgate

Pressgate rebuilds only pages whose source changed since the last run. Do not trigger full rebuilds during business hours; they block the queue for ~20 minutes. If a partial rebuild misses a page, check the content hash cache first, then requeue the single path. Full rebuilds are for the nightly window only. The rebuild service runs with the following configuration values.

deployment values, yadug-bawif:
[framir]
team = pelox
access_code = ac_a38ab2
owner = tamion.julael
host = framir.tolvaqlabs.test
port = 11211
peer = tammir.zemvargrid.local
salt = 2215ef03
pin = 1541

**TICKET-2093: Ledger artifact fails signature verification**

The loyalty-points ledger service (Pointsmith) won't deploy — signature check fails on the 1.8.0 artifact. Pretty sure the build box still trusts the retired key from the spring rotation. Reviewer: please confirm the trust-store patch below is correct. The expected signing key follows.

rollout seal: bky4_x7Gc

**Ticket CALC-982 — Formula sandbox escape via nested imports**

So, the Tallygrove formula sandbox isn't as sealed as we thought. A user-supplied formula can chain nested helper calls to reach the evaluator's parent scope and read config values it shouldn't see. No evidence of abuse yet, but treat as high priority. Short-term mitigation: flip `strict_scope` on in the Perch config and restart workers — that blocks the chain. Patch is ready and passed the regression suite; the validated build is below.

trace token, fafog-kageg: htk4_98e6